When to Check and Change Automatic Transmission Fluid

A good time to check the automatic transmission fluid level is when the engine oil is changed.

Change the fluid and filter at the intervals listed in Maintenance Schedule on page 11‑3 and be sure to use the transmission fluid listed in Recommended Fluids and Lubricants on page 11‑12.
